The Coast Guard Cutter Reliance is a medium endurance cutter which, like other cutters in its class, is primarily assigned law enforcement and search and rescue missions. It can support one HH-65A helicopter, but no hangar is provided. All ships of its class have undergone or will undergo Midlife Maintenance Availability (MMA) during the next several years. The purpose of MMA is to upgrade machinery and equipment in order that the class may remain mission capable, supportable, and reliable for the second half of its service life.
